The State Oceanic Administration Key Laboratory of Polar Science was formally established on September 28th, 2004. Relying on China Polar Research Institute, the laboratory focuses on the national demand of polar exploration in China and the major frontier scientific issues of polar scientific research, gives full play to the role of research platforms such as "Snow Dragon" ship and China Antarctic and Antarctic research station, establishes an open, joint, mobile and competitive operation mechanism, and shares the samples, data and information resources obtained from polar exploration. Through the observation of polar science, the continuous construction of experimental system and the accumulation of scientific research, great theoretical and technological achievements have been made in some basic research and application fields of polar science, a polar scientific research team with international influence has been trained and brought up, and a world-class polar scientific research cooperation center has been gradually formed, which has safeguarded China's polar rights and interests and served the national economic construction.

(1) Research direction of polar ice and snow and marine environment
On the basis of long-term continuous field observation, satellite remote sensing observation and laboratory analysis, through the innovation of theory and research methods, the key physical and chemical processes of polar ice sheets, glaciers, ice shelves, sea ice, oceans and atmosphere and their changes are emphatically studied, and the response and feedback of polar ice and snow and oceans to global changes are understood, including:
Study on ice and snow mass balance and sea level change
Study on the Modern Process of Ice, Snow and Air
Study on climatic and environmental records of ice cores
Study on sea ice change and physical process
Study on the change process of polar ocean characteristic water mass and circulation
Study on the interaction of sea ice-ocean-atmosphere system
(2) The research direction of polar ionosphere-magnetosphere coupling and space weather.
Give full play to the geographical advantages of Zhongshan Station in Antarctica and Huanghe Station in China, Arctic, which are located at the latitude of the earth's polar gap and form a yoke, establish a field observation system of polar space physics, continuously monitor the polar space environment, carry out the coupling study of polar ionosphere and magnetosphere, further understand the key process of magnetosphere, ionosphere and upper atmosphere responding to solar activities, and explore the physical methods of field reporting and forecasting space weather by using polar ground observation stations. Mainly includes:
Study on ionospheric characteristics and dynamic processes at high latitudes
Study on the dynamic process of aurora and magnetosphere
Study on plasma waves in polar space
Study on coupling characteristics and model of ionosphere-magnetosphere in polar region
Basic research on field report and forecast of space weather
(3) The research direction of polar ecological environment and its life process.
By monitoring and analyzing the ecology and ecological environment in the polar sea ice area, the polar marine ecosystem is studied.
Structure, process, coupling with physical process and its response to climate and environmental changes; Investigate the germplasm resources of polar microorganisms, and study the characteristics of germplasm and gene resources, environmental adaptability and resource utilization technology of polar microorganisms, mainly including:
Ecological study on polar sea ice area
Monitoring and research of polar ecological environment
Study on life process and active substances of polar microorganisms
